"""Unit tests for BaseLlmFlow toolset integration."""
from unittest import mock
from unittest.mock import AsyncMock
from google.adk.agents.llm_agent import Agent
from google.adk.events.event import Event
from google.adk.flows.llm_flows.base_llm_flow import BaseLlmFlow
from google.adk.models.google_llm import Gemini
from google.adk.models.llm_request import LlmRequest
from google.adk.models.llm_response import LlmResponse
from google.adk.plugins.base_plugin import BasePlugin
from google.adk.tools.base_toolset import BaseToolset
from google.adk.tools.google_search_tool import GoogleSearchTool
from google.genai import types
import pytest
from ... import testing_utils
google_search = GoogleSearchTool(bypass_multi_tools_limit=True)
class BaseLlmFlowForTesting(BaseLlmFlow):
"""Test implementation of BaseLlmFlow for testing purposes."""
pass
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_preprocess_calls_toolset_process_llm_request():
"""Test that _preprocess_async calls process_llm_request on toolsets."""
# Create a mock toolset that tracks if process_llm_request was called
class _MockToolset(BaseToolset):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__()
self.process_llm_request_called = False
self.process_llm_request = AsyncMock(side_effect=self._track_call)
async def _track_call(self, **kwargs):
self.process_llm_request_called = True
async def get_tools(self, readonly_context=None):
return []
async def close(self):
pass
mock_toolset = _MockToolset()
# Create a mock model that returns a simple response
mock_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(
role='model', par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='Test response')]
),
partial=False,
)
mock_model = testing_utils.MockModel.create(responses=[mock_response])
# Create agent with the mock toolset
agent = Agent(name='test_agent', model=mock_model, tools=[mock_toolset])
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, user_content='test message'
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
# Call _preprocess_async
llm_request = LlmRequest()
events = []
async for event in flow._preprocess_async(invocation_context, llm_request):
events.append(event)
# Verify that process_llm_request was called on the toolset
assert mock_toolset.process_llm_request_called
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_preprocess_handles_mixed_tools_and_toolsets():
"""Test that _preprocess_async properly handles both tools and toolsets."""
from google.adk.tools.base_tool import BaseTool
# Create a mock tool
class _MockTool(BaseTool):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__(name='mock_tool', description='Mock tool')
self.process_llm_request_called = False
self.process_llm_request = AsyncMock(side_effect=self._track_call)
async def _track_call(self, **kwargs):
self.process_llm_request_called = True
async def call(self, **kwargs):
return 'mock result'
# Create a mock toolset
class _MockToolset(BaseToolset):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__()
self.process_llm_request_called = False
self.process_llm_request = AsyncMock(side_effect=self._track_call)
async def _track_call(self, **kwargs):
self.process_llm_request_called = True
async def get_tools(self, readonly_context=None):
return []
async def close(self):
pass
def _test_function():
"""Test function tool."""
return 'function result'
mock_tool = _MockTool()
mock_toolset = _MockToolset()
# Create agent with mixed tools and toolsets
agent = Agent(
name='test_agent', tools=[mock_tool, _test_function, mock_toolset]
)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, user_content='test message'
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
# Call _preprocess_async
llm_request = LlmRequest()
events = []
async for event in flow._preprocess_async(invocation_context, llm_request):
events.append(event)
# Verify that process_llm_request was called on both tools and toolsets
assert mock_tool.process_llm_request_called
assert mock_toolset.process_llm_request_called
# TODO(b/448114567): Remove the following test_preprocess_with_google_search
# tests once the workaround is no longer needed.
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_preprocess_with_google_search_only():
"""Test _preprocess_async with only the google_search tool."""
agent = Agent(name='test_agent', model='gemini-pro', tools=[google_search])
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, user_content='test message'
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
llm_request = LlmRequest(model='gemini-pro')
async for _ in flow._preprocess_async(invocation_context, llm_request):
pass
assert len(llm_request.config.tools) == 1
assert llm_request.config.tools[0].google_search is not None
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_preprocess_with_google_search_workaround():
"""Test _preprocess_async with google_search and another tool."""
def _my_tool(sides: int) -> int:
"""A simple tool."""
return sides
agent = Agent(
name='test_agent', model='gemini-pro', tools=[_my_tool, google_search]
)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, user_content='test message'
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
llm_request = LlmRequest(model='gemini-pro')
async for _ in flow._preprocess_async(invocation_context, llm_request):
pass
assert len(llm_request.config.tools) == 1
declarations = llm_request.config.tools[0].function_declarations
assert len(declarations) == 2
assert {d.name for d in declarations} == {'_my_tool', 'google_search_agent'}
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_preprocess_calls_convert_tool_union_to_tools():
"""Test that _preprocess_async calls _convert_tool_union_to_tools."""
class _MockTool:
process_llm_request = AsyncMock()
mock_tool_instance = _MockTool()
def _my_tool(sides: int) -> int:
"""A simple tool."""
return sides
with mock.patch(
'google.adk.agents.llm_agent._convert_tool_union_to_tools',
new_callable=AsyncMock,
) as mock_convert:
mock_convert.return_value = [mock_tool_instance]
model = Gemini(model='gemini-2')
agent = Agent(
name='test_agent', model=model, tools=[_my_tool, google_search]
)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, user_content='test message'
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
llm_request = LlmRequest(model='gemini-2')
async for _ in flow._preprocess_async(invocation_context, llm_request):
pass
mock_convert.assert_called_with(
google_search,
mock.ANY, # ReadonlyContext(invocation_context)
model,
True, # multiple_tools
)
# TODO(b/448114567): Remove the following
# test_handle_after_model_callback_grounding tests once the workaround
# is no longer needed.
def dummy_tool():
pass
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
't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ata',
[
([], None,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, True),
([d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], None, False),
],
ids=[
'no_search_no_grounding',
'with_search_with_grounding',
'no_search_with_grounding',
'with_search_no_grounding',
],
)
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_handle_after_model_callback_grounding_with_no_callbacks(
t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ata
):
"""Test handling grounding metadata when there are no callbacks."""
agent = Agent(name='test_agent', tools=tools)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ent
)
if state_metadata:
invocation_context.session.state['temp:_adk_grounding_metadata'] = (
state_metadata
)
llm_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='response')])
)
event = Event(
id=Event.new_id(),
invocation_id=invocation_context.invocation_id,
author=agent.name,
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
result =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
if expect_metadata:
llm_response.grounding_metadata = state_metadata
assert result == llm_response
else:
assert result is None
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
't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ata',
[
([], None,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, True),
([d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], None, False),
],
ids=[
'no_search_no_grounding',
'with_search_with_grounding',
'no_search_with_grounding',
'with_search_no_grounding',
],
)
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_handle_after_model_callback_grounding_with_callback_override(
t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ata
):
"""Test handling grounding metadata when there is a callback override."""
agent_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='agent')])
)
agent_callback = AsyncMock(return_value=agent_response)
agent = Agent(
name='test_agent', tools=tools, after_model_callback=[agent_callback]
)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ent
)
if state_metadata:
invocation_context.session.state['temp:_adk_grounding_metadata'] = (
state_metadata
)
llm_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='response')])
)
event = Event(
id=Event.new_id(),
invocation_id=invocation_context.invocation_id,
author=agent.name,
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
result =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
if expect_metadata:
agent_response.grounding_metadata = state_metadata
assert result == agent_response
agent_callback.assert_called_once()
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
't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ata',
[
([], None,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, True),
([dummy_tool], {'foo': 'bar'}, False),
([google_search, dummy_tool], None, False),
],
ids=[
'no_search_no_grounding',
'with_search_with_grounding',
'no_search_with_grounding',
'with_search_no_grounding',
],
)
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_handle_after_model_callback_grounding_with_plugin_override(
tools, state_metadata, expect_metadata
):
"""Test handling grounding metadata when there is a plugin override."""
plugin_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='plugin')])
)
class _MockPlugin(BasePlugin):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__(name='mock_plugin')
after_model_callback = AsyncMock(return_value=plugin_response)
plugin = _MockPlugin()
agent = Agent(name='test_agent', tools=tools)
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ent, plugins=[plugin]
)
if state_metadata:
invocation_context.session.state['temp:_adk_grounding_metadata'] = (
state_metadata
)
llm_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='response')])
)
event = Event(
id=Event.new_id(),
invocation_id=invocation_context.invocation_id,
author=agent.name,
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
result =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
if expect_metadata:
plugin_response.grounding_metadata = state_metadata
assert result == plugin_response
plugin.after_model_callback.assert_called_once()
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_handle_after_model_callback_caches_canonical_tools():
"""Test that canonical_tools is only called once per invocation_context."""
canonical_tools_call_count = 0
async def mock_canonical_tools(self, readonly_context=None):
nonlocal canonical_tools_call_count
canonical_tools_call_count += 1
from google.adk.tools.base_tool import BaseTool
class MockGoogleSearchTool(BaseTool):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__(name='google_search_agent', description='Mock search')
async def call(self, **kwargs):
return 'mock result'
return [MockGoogleSearchTool()]
agent = Agent(name='test_agent', tools=[google_search, dummy_tool])
with mock.patch.object(
type(agent), 'canonical_tools', new=mock_canonical_tools
):
invocation_context = await testing_utils.create_invocation_context(
agent=agent
)
assert invocation_context.canonical_tools_cache is None
invocation_context.session.state['temp:_adk_grounding_metadata'] = {
'foo': 'bar'
}
llm_response = LlmResponse(
content=types.Content(parts=[types.Part.from_text(text='response')])
)
event = Event(
id=Event.new_id(),
invocation_id=invocation_context.invocation_id,
author=agent.name,
)
flow = BaseLlmFlowForTesting()
# Call _handle_after_model_callback multiple times with the same context
result1 =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
result2 =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
result3 = await flow._handle_after_model_callback(
invocation_context, llm_response, event
)
assert canonical_tools_call_count == 1, (
'canonical_tools should be called once, but was called '
f'{canonical_tools_call_count} times'
)
assert invocation_context.canonical_tools_cache is not None
assert len(invocation_context.canonical_tools_cache) == 1
assert (
invocation_context.canonical_tools_cache[0].name
== 'google_search_agent'
)
assert result1.grounding_metadata == {'foo': 'bar'}
assert result2.grounding_metadata == {'foo': 'bar'}
assert result3.grounding_metadata == {'foo': 'bar'}
